Psalm 73:26 Meaning

My flesh and my heart faileth: but God is the strength of my heart, and my portion for ever.

Context Explained

24Thou shalt guide me with thy counsel, and afterward receive me to glory.

25Whom have I in heaven but thee? and there is none upon earth that I desire beside thee.

26My flesh and my heart faileth: but God is the strength of my heart, and my portion for ever.

27For, lo, they that are far from thee shall perish: thou hast destroyed all them that go a whoring from thee.

28But it is good for me to draw near to God: I have put my trust in the Lord GOD, that I may declare all thy works.

Related Cross References

  • Isaiah 40:31

    Both verses emphasize that God provides strength to those who trust in Him.

  • Psalm 46:1

    God is described as a refuge and strength, resonating with the psalmist's declaration.

  • 2 Corinthians 12:9

    Paul speaks of God's strength being made perfect in weakness, aligning with the psalmist's reliance on God.
